ground beef bell pepper cheddar omelette ingredients

Ingredients

  • 3 eggs
  • 1/4 cup chopped bell pepper
  • 1/4 cup cooked ground beef
  • 1/4 cup shredded cheddar cheese
  • 1 tablespoon butter or cooking oil
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Instructions

  1. Heat the butter or cooking oil in a non-stick skillet over medium heat.
  2. In a small bowl, whisk the eggs with salt and pepper to taste.
  3. Pour the eggs into the skillet and let them cook for about a minute until the edges start to set.
  4. Add the chopped bell pepper, cooked ground beef, and shredded cheddar cheese to one side of the omelette.
  5. Using a spatula, fold the other side of the omelette over the filling and cook for another minute or until the cheese is melted and the eggs are cooked through.
  6. Slide the omelette onto a plate and serve hot!

How long does ground beef bell pepper cheddar omelette last in the fridge?

Cooked ground beef bell pepper cheddar omelette can be stored in the fridge for up to four days. However, it is important to store it properly in an airtight container or wrap it tightly with plastic wrap to prevent moisture and bacteria growth. To reheat the omelette, you can either use a microwave or a skillet over medium heat until it is heated through. Avoid reheating the omelette more than once to prevent the risk of foodborne illness. It is recommended to consume the omelette within two days of cooking to ensure maximum freshness and flavor.

Low calorie ground beef bell pepper cheddar omelette recipe substitutions

To make this recipe lower calorie, you can substitute some of the ingredients with healthier and lower calorie alternatives. For instance, you can use egg whites instead of whole eggs. This will significantly reduce the calorie and fat content of the dish. You can also use lean ground beef or turkey instead of regular ground beef to cut down on the fat content. Moreover, you can use low-fat cheddar cheese or eliminate the cheese altogether and add some more veggies such as spinach or mushrooms to increase the fiber content of the dish and make it more filling. Finally, cooking the omelette with a non-stick cooking spray instead of butter can further cut down the calories and fat. These substitutions will make the recipe lower calorie while still maintaining its taste and nutritional value.

Whats the best sauce for ground beef bell pepper cheddar omelette?

One sauce that could pair well with a ground beef, bell pepper, and cheddar omelette is a classic tomato sauce. The acidity and sweetness of the tomato sauce will complement the richness of the eggs and cheese, while the savory flavor will balance out the beef. To make the sauce, start by sautéing garlic and onions in olive oil, then add diced canned tomatoes and simmer until the sauce has thickened. Season with salt, pepper, and dried herbs like thyme or oregano to enhance the flavor. Drizzle the sauce over the omelette and serve immediately.

Ground beef bell pepper cheddar omelette health benefits

The ground beef bell pepper cheddar omelette is a high-protein dish and a good source of essential nutrients such as iron, zinc, and vitamin B12. Bell peppers are low in calories but high in vitamins C and A. However, the use of ground beef and cheddar cheese can make this dish high in saturated fat and cholesterol, which can be detrimental to cardiovascular health if consumed in excess. As an alternative, a vegetable omelette made with egg whites and a variety of vegetables like spinach, mushrooms, and tomatoes can provide similar nutrient benefits while being lower in fat and calories. Adding a small amount of low-fat cheese or feta can still provide flavor without adding excessive saturated fat.
